Re: Force Roam in new Sprint ROM

Quote:
Originally Posted by mindfrost82 View Post
I think Alltel is the only roaming partner that allows EVDO, all others will only roam on 1X, so that's normal. In most areas we will roam on Verizon, which only allows us 1X.
When I need evdo and Sprint is only 1X I just flash with an alltel branded prl and instant evdo

Just search for alltel 40029.prl
put it on your storage card
##778# select edit enter your code
select prl from menu
highlight update prl
select edit from lower right hand bottom
navigate to the Alltel prl on your phone and update

When it resets you will have evdo if Alltel has it in your area

to go back just do the same thing with a sprint prl that you dl and put on your phone (look for 60612.prl)

Re: Force Roam in new Sprint ROM

OK, I have the problem most have been experiencing. I am with Sprint, WM6.1, PRL 60613, trying to get voice/data roaming in Wash DC subway tunnels (Verizon territory).
Sprint has NO signal inside the metro tunnels whatsoever.
The phone does switch to roaming, I can see the triangle and the 1x symbols coming up (Verizon does not do EVDO). But there is no communication at all, voice nor data. No internet, no text messages, no voice (getting the infamous msg from Verizon, phone not authorized).
I had PRL 60613, but still called Sprint to make sure the update was registered on their side, reloaded 60613... nothing. Downgraded to PRL 60610... nothing.
The interesting part is, when I'm at home (Alexandria, VA), both data/voice roaming work. But I commute to work everyday, so I get on the metro on my way to MD via DC. Roaming has the problems described in those areas. Perhaps at home my roaming is being picked from non-Verizon towers.
Anyway, in researching i found that requesting Sprint to perform a "HLR reload" has been reported to fix the issue for many. I did so tonight. I don't know what the outcome will be until tomorrow morning when I get on the metro again.
I will report the outcome some time from work. Wish me luck.

PS-while doing the PRL updates using EPST Config, I discovered my phone didn't have Rev A enabled... made the change and now, while in Sprint network, speed has increased considerably... at least something good came out of this already!

Re: Force Roam in new Sprint ROM

Confirmed!!!
HLR reload worked. Now I am able to voice/data roam in the Wash DC metro tunnels (red line).
So I can state that you should be able to roam using WM 6.1 with PRL 60613. No need to downgrade to 60610. I would even recommend to everybody to stay current on your PRLs. Just make sure when you call Sprint to also reload your HLR.
When you do so, remember to let them know what zip-codes you mostly roam in.
Hope this helps.

Re: Force Roam in new Sprint ROM

Quote:
Originally Posted by jj4201998 View Post
How do you determine if Rev A is enabled or not.
Taken from: http://forums.buzzaboutwireless.com/...essage.id=3523
---
"A confusing issue with the new ROM is the Rev. A toggle. Some users on other forums are suggesting that the Rev. A toggle in the EPST settings should be changed to "Enabled" after flashing the ROM. However, this will actually disable Rev. A.

If you access the Data Parameters screen of the EPST settings after flashing the new ROM, you will notice that the Rev. A toggle settings are actually labeled "Enable" and "Disable", not "Enabled" and "Disabled". The labels are not a description of the toggle status, but are the action performed by activating the toggle. In other words, when it says "Disable", it is enabled, and if you activate the toggle, you will "Disable" Rev. A.

Very confusing, eh? That also explains why the ROM shipped with "Disable" in the label, as Rev. A is enabled by default, and activating the toggle will "Disable" it.

Bottom line: If you want Rev. A enabled, your EPST settings should show "Disable". If you do not know what EPST settings are, or how to access them, no worries; the ROM is shipped with Rev. A enabled, and there is no need to make any change there. "
----
(So I won't take credit for this, but Thanks are always nice!)


Edit:
If you want to test that this actually works, do a speed test on your phone before and after the change. My speeds went from the 100's to 700's kbps. It could be better, but still an improvement.
